About This Software

Interop.Capicom.dll is a wrapper for the Microsoft CAPICOM library, providing cryptographic services for .NET applications. This DLL is commonly used for digital signatures, certificate management, and encryption tasks. When missing, applications may fail to start or perform cryptographic operations.
